Asphalt Shingle Roofing Built for the York Area's Weather

Homes in and around the York neighborhood sit close enough to the water and the tree canopy that they take a different kind of beating than roofs further inland. Salt-laden air moves in off Bellingham Bay, driving rain comes sideways during winter storms, and the shade from mature trees keeps roof surfaces damp for days after the rain stops. That combination is exactly what shortens the life of a shingle roof that wasn't installed with this specific climate in mind. We've replaced and repaired enough roofs in this part of Whatcom County to know which failure points show up here first, and we build every roof to address them from day one rather than patching problems after they appear.

Why Asphalt Shingles Still Make Sense Here

Asphalt shingles remain the most practical roofing material for the majority of homes in this area, and for good reason. They're proven, they're serviceable by almost any roofer if something ever needs attention down the road, and modern architectural shingles hold up well against wind and rain when they're installed correctly. The key phrase is "installed correctly" — asphalt shingle roofing fails early in this climate almost always because of installation shortcuts, not because the material itself is wrong for the job.

What Matters More Than the Shingle Brand

Homeowners often ask us which shingle brand is best. That question matters less than most people expect. What actually determines whether a roof lasts 20 years or 12 years in a coastal, moss-prone climate is the underlayment system, the ventilation, the flashing detail work, and the fastening pattern. We'll talk shingle options with you, but we spend more time on the parts of the roof you'll never see once it's done — because those are the parts that decide whether you're calling us back in year eight.

The Local Climate Problems We Build Around

Moss and Prolonged Moisture

Whatcom County's long, wet shoulder seasons and shaded lots create ideal conditions for moss growth on roofing. Moss isn't just cosmetic — it holds moisture against the shingle surface, works its way under shingle edges, and lifts granules over time, which shortens the life of the roof underneath it. Roofs with poor ventilation or shingles installed with tight nailing patterns are more vulnerable, because trapped moisture has nowhere to escape and dry out between rain events.

Driving Rain and Wind-Driven Water

Storms coming off the water push rain sideways instead of straight down, which means water gets tested against every seam, valley, and penetration on the roof, not just the open field of shingles. A roof that would perform fine in a drier climate with looser flashing details can leak here specifically because the wind pushes water uphill under improperly lapped flashing.

Salt Air and Metal Corrosion

Proximity to the bay means airborne salt reaches roofing hardware — nails, flashing, vent stacks, and drip edge — faster than it would further inland. Standard galvanized fasteners can start corroding years before the shingles themselves wear out, which is why we default to corrosion-resistant fasteners and flashing on roofs in this area rather than treating it as an upgrade.

What a Correct Asphalt Shingle Roof Involves

A roof that's going to hold up here needs more than shingles nailed to plywood. Every layer underneath does a job:

  • Ice-and-water shield at eaves, valleys, and around penetrations — the first line of defense where wind-driven rain and ice damming are most likely to force water backward under shingles
  • Synthetic or felt underlayment across the full deck, lapped correctly so every seam sheds water downhill
  • Balanced ventilation — intake at the eaves and exhaust at the ridge, sized to actually move air through the attic rather than just checking a box
  • Proper flashing at every wall intersection, chimney, skylight, and valley, using step flashing and counter-flashing rather than relying on roofing cement alone
  • Corrosion-resistant fasteners rated for coastal exposure, driven at the manufacturer's specified pattern and depth
  • Drip edge on all edges to keep water off the fascia and out of the roof deck's edge grain

Skip any one of these and the roof might look fine for a few years. In this climate, the shortcuts show up as leaks, moss colonies, or granule loss well before the shingle's rated lifespan is up.

Our Process for a York-Area Roof Replacement

1. On-Site Inspection and Honest Assessment

We start by getting on the roof, not just looking at it from the ground. We check the deck for soft spots or rot, look at existing ventilation, note any moss or algae staining, and inspect flashing at every penetration. We'll tell you plainly if a repair is a reasonable option or if replacement is the better long-term investment — we don't upsell a full tear-off when a targeted repair will genuinely hold.

2. A Written Scope Before Any Work Starts

You get a clear, written scope covering tear-off, deck repair allowances, underlayment type, ventilation plan, flashing approach, and shingle selection — so there's no ambiguity about what's included before a crew shows up.

3. Tear-Off and Deck Inspection

Old roofing comes off down to the deck so we can actually see what we're building on. Any damaged or soft decking gets replaced before a single course of underlayment goes down — nothing gets covered up.

4. Underlayment, Flashing, and Ventilation Installed First

This is the layer that determines how the roof performs in driving rain, and it's the layer most likely to get rushed by crews trying to move fast. We install it methodically, because it's the hardest part to fix later.

5. Shingle Installation to Manufacturer Spec

Nailing pattern, exposure, and starter course all follow the manufacturer's requirements exactly — this is also what keeps the manufacturer's warranty valid if you ever need to make a claim.

6. Final Walkthrough

We walk the finished roof and the property with you, clean up thoroughly, and go over care and maintenance specific to your roof and lot — including whether moss treatment or gutter changes make sense given your tree cover.

Comparing Roofing Approaches for This Climate

FactorBudget/Minimum-Code InstallBuilt-for-Climate Install
Underlayment coverageFelt at field only, minimal ice-and-waterIce-and-water at all vulnerable points, full synthetic underlayment
FastenersStandard galvanizedCorrosion-resistant, coastal-rated
VentilationWhatever existed before, unchangedBalanced intake/exhaust sized to the attic
FlashingReused where possible, sealant-dependentNew step and counter-flashing at all penetrations
Expected performance in moss/rain climateEarlier granule loss, higher leak risk at valleysLonger serviceable life, fewer callback issues

The upfront cost difference between these two approaches is real, but it's small relative to the cost of a premature re-roof or repeated leak repairs. Maintenance That Actually Extends Roof Life Here

A well-installed shingle roof still needs some attention in this climate, especially on shaded or tree-covered lots. A short seasonal checklist:

  • Keep gutters clear so water isn't backing up under the eave line, especially after fall leaf drop
  • Have moss growth addressed early — light growth is easy to manage, established colonies do real damage to the shingle surface
  • Trim back overhanging branches to cut down on shade, debris, and moisture retention on the roof
  • Have flashing and valleys checked after major windstorms, since that's where wind-driven rain finds weak points first
  • Schedule a roof check every few years even if there's no visible problem — small issues are cheap to fix, deferred ones aren't

How long does a properly installed asphalt shingle roof typically last in this climate?

A well-installed architectural shingle roof with proper underlayment and ventilation can commonly reach 25-30 years in this region, though shaded, moss-prone lots tend toward the lower end of that range. Poor ventilation or skipped flashing details can cut that significantly. Regular moss management and gutter maintenance help protect the full lifespan.

What questions should I ask before hiring a roofing contractor in this area?

Ask specifically what underlayment they use at eaves and valleys, whether they replace flashing or reuse it, and what fastener type they install given the salt air exposure. Ask for proof of licensing and insurance, and ask how they handle deck repairs discovered during tear-off. A contractor who can answer these clearly, without vague reassurances, is usually one worth hiring.

Does the shingle brand matter as much as installation quality?

Installation quality matters more in this climate. Most major architectural shingle lines perform similarly when installed to spec, but poor underlayment, flashing, or ventilation will undermine even a premium shingle. What's the difference between 3-tab and architectural (dimensional) shingles?

Architectural shingles are thicker, heavier, and rated for higher wind speeds than older 3-tab designs, which makes them a better fit for storm-driven rain and wind common here. They also tend to shed moss and debris slightly better due to their layered profile. Most homeowners in this area choose architectural shingles for that added durability.

Is moss on a roof in the York area something to worry about right away?

Light moss isn't an emergency, but it shouldn't be ignored either, since it holds moisture against the shingle surface and can lift edges over time. The sooner it's treated or removed, the less damage it does to the granule layer underneath. If moss is heavy or has been there for more than a season, it's worth having the roof inspected for underlying damage.
